In first aid, the recovery position (also called semi-prone) is one of a series of variations on a lateral recumbent or three-quarters prone position of the body, often used for unconscious but breathing casualties. Web8 dec. 2024 · Personal recovery capital can be divided into physical and human capital (Hennessey, 2024; Tew, 2012 ). A person’s physical recovery capital includes physical health, financial assets, health insurance, safe and recovery-conducive shelter, clothing, food, and access to transportation. Web30 okt. 2024 · The recovery position is a position in which a person is lying on their side with their head tilted backwards and their chin pointing upwards. This position is often used for people who are unconscious or who have had a seizure. It is also sometimes used for people who are vomiting.
